Whole-length bandit standing directed to the right, pointing with his index finger at gun in his other hand, looking towards the viewer, in headscarf under hat, boots; after bécquer. 1836 hand-coloured lithograph. Date: 1836. Dimensions: Height: 245 mm (image); Width: 180 mm. Medium: paper. Collection: British Museum. The Bandit (BM 1866,0512.3057)
